.window-selection h2,
.window-selection .ts-meta-h2 {
    margin-top: 10px;
}

.window-selection__title-block {
    text-align: center;
}

.window-selection__subtitle {
    margin-top: 30px;
    font-weight: 500;
    font-size: 20px;
    line-height: 140%;
}

.window-selection .window-selection__quiz-block {
    margin-top: 50px;
}

@media (max-width: 576px) {
    .window-selection__subtitle {
        font-size: 16px;
    }
}

@media (max-width: 1024px) {
    .quiz {
        flex-direction: column;
        background: #fff;
        box-shadow: 0px 17px 100px -11px #e0e8e8;
        border-radius: 12px;
    }
}

@media (max-width: 650px) {
    .quiz__content {
        grid-template-columns: 1fr 1fr;
        gap: 50px 16px;
    }
}
